FSU Media Day Recap, Jimbo Fisher Comments on Relationship with WIll Muschamp
For the first time in over a decade, Florida State has high expectations for a once-dominant football program. It showed as much at FSU Media Day on Sunday, with dozens of reporters joining the buzz about the Seminole program. FSU is ranked fifth in the USA Today preseason poll, returning nine starters on defense and nine on offense, but lose quarterback Christian Ponder to the NFL. Redshirt junior E.J. Manuel will take the reins to the Nole offense. Manuel is 4-2 as a starter, and teammates don't expect a drop off at the QB position heading into the season.
Jimbo Fisher is in his second year as a head coach, and had complimentary words for new Gator head coach Will Muschamp. Even though the two will be bitter enemies on the gridiron, Fisher says he and Muschamp have had these battles before.
